Transaction 2c6928d8253ac1db59b6973473253106c9f9d39148ef20e32a4293e31dddebc1

1 Input
2 Outputs
  • 2c6928d8253ac1db59b6973473253106c9f9d39148ef20e32a4293e31dddebc1:0
  • value  3643312
    address  33TQFa59Xfo84K3pP7xQWCXbJzTbbab2fL
  • 2c6928d8253ac1db59b6973473253106c9f9d39148ef20e32a4293e31dddebc1:1
  • value  34498120
    address  14mrWTj9wSnxF8iWHKLMyepbm4vNTF1tXm